The invention relates to a device for preventing missed tapping of a tapping machine and a workpiece processing system, which belong to the field of mold processing. The device for preventing missed tapping of a tapping machine comprises a control box and a tapping machine. The tapping machine comprises a clamping mechanism for fixing a workpiece, a tap matched with the clamping mechanism, and a first driving device for driving the tap. The clamping mechanism comprises a fixing part, a clamping part matched with the fixing part, and a second driving device for driving the clamping part. A first detection device for receiving a working signal of the tap is provided on the side of the clamping mechanism close to the tap, and a second detection device for receiving a working signal of the tap is provided on the side of the clamping mechanism away from the tap. The first driving device, the second driving device, the first detection device, and the second detection device are respectively connected to the control box for communication. The workpiece processing system comprises the above-mentioned device for preventing missed tapping of a tapping machine. The invention solves the problem in the prior art that defective products are mixed into the finished product due to missed drilling, missed tapping, or inadequate tapping during tapping operation.
